Applied Word Problems: Money, Mixture & Distance

Set up equations for the three classic applied scenarios the GAT-E reuses.

~6 min readDifficulty 3/5

Money / coins

Track the VALUE, not just the count. If there are n coins of 5 and of 10:

Set the value equal to the given total and solve.

Mixtures

Track the amount of the key ingredient before and after.

The pure-ingredient amounts add up; so do the volumes.

Distance / motion

distance speed time. Build one equation per traveller, then relate them.

A reliable routine

  1. Name the unknown.
  2. Write each quantity (value / pure amount / distance) in terms of it.
  3. Use the condition (a total, an equality, a meeting) to form one equation.

Tips

  • For coins/notes, write the total VALUE (count denomination), not just counts.
  • For mixtures, the pure-ingredient amounts add and the volumes add.
  • Opposite directions add speeds; same direction subtracts them.

Common mistakes

Summing coin counts instead of their values
Why: Counts are the obvious quantity.
Fix: Multiply each count by its denomination to get value.
Adding speeds for two travellers going the same way
Why: Adding feels like "combining".
Fix: Same direction subtract speeds (relative speed); opposite add.
